I just finished watching this series. Though it's confusing, it's not as confusing as some other series like Noein, and its conclusion is less vague as Eureka 7.

What do I like with Xam? The animation is heavily reminiscent of Miyazaki's style. The heroin reminds me of Valley of the Wind, and the airships are similar to that in Castle in the Sky. Also, I'm very glad to see the details in the animation.

Music-wise is top-notch. That insert song just makes me wanna cry. Such a beautiful piece of music!

Characters...... um, they need more characterisation, more fleshing out. I think the impact in the last few episodes would have been greater if we had more time on characterisation. Still, the characters did kind of grow on you. Yango for example. He's one of my top favourite characters despite the little amount of screen time he gets. I think it's probably his straightforwardness that makes me like him so much.

As for the ending..... Akiyuki's revival did make me think whether it was just a more dramatic way of ending the series in a circular method. Bring it back to full circle by showing the audience that Haru and Akiyuki love each other even though Akiyuki has turned into stone. As somebody's already said in previous posts - we didn't get any indication that a person could be revived once he turns completely into stone. uh.. I dunno. I want to think that Akiyuki's truly back? Based on what Nakiami said. (oh, Nakiami, another great character, though I wish I could see more behind her motivation)

All in all, a pretty good series. 7-8/10, and more points if it had been longer.

So I went back and rewatched this show, and I have to say the greatest flaw is the lack of closure. Why are the humanforms different from the xam'd, what was the purpose of nakiami's sacrifice, the hints at the hiruken emperor left a void that didn't give him a truly big bad feel, in the end the actually story telling elements used only cluttered the story and any hope for closure is lost. If bones does choose to do a reboot I hope that it will be this series and that they think out some of these questions and really direct it in a manner that explains things that are pretty critical to the motivation of most of the characters. In the end we only see the surface and there is no real connection because although the characters are awesome the currents that drive them are really not there and for the most part their actions seem foreign and unrelateable to the viewer.

Just watched it and read a few posts back..

I agree having another 13-26 episodes really could have fleshed out the plot and characters a lot more, hell even just one episode dedicated to explaining some of the terminology would've been nice.

I like most of the characters I was a little disappointed to see Fuji kill himself in the end though and was kinda surprised no one really brought it up later, Akiyuki never even mentions his name or anything for the rest of the series despite that he was his best friend.

Ending was okay, better then I thought it was going to be honestly because everyone I ever talked to said the ending was one of the worst they've ever seen. Like someone mentioned it wasn't a plot driven story it was a character driven story and for that the story ended well. Although like others have said there's still a war going on and plot wise nothing was really solved in the overall story.

I can see why a lot of people would be frustrated watching this series in 26 weeks but its easier to keep up with everything watching it over the course of a few days instead.

Overall not a great anime but pretty good, would like to see an extended cut of the series in the future but I doubt that'll ever happen.
